Warnings: Patients with early Leber's disease (hereditary optic nerve atrophy) may experience severe and rapid optic atrophy when treated with vitamin B12. Additionally, treating severe megaloblastic anemia with vitamin B12 can lead to fatal hypokalemia due to increased erythrocyte potassium requirements
